What companies run services between Arbroath, Scotland and Tobermory, Scotland?

There is no direct connection from Arbroath to Tobermory. However, you can take the train to Glasgow Queen Street, take the train to Oban, walk to Oban Ferry Terminal, take the ferry to Craignure Mull Ferry Terminal, walk to Ferry Terminal, then take the line 95 bus to Ledaig Car Park.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bus Station to Ledaig Car Park via Seagate Bus Station, Buchanan Bus Station, Bus Station, Oban Ferry Terminal, Craignure Mull Ferry Terminal, and Ferry Terminal in around 9h 55m.
